There are three organs that are the most responsible for providing our body with enzymes. They are the stomach small intestine, and the pancreas.

Among these, the pancreas is regarded as an enzyme “powerhouse” in the human body since it supplies the enzymes that are responsible for breaking down proteins, carbohydrates and fats.

You may already know this, but there are many kinds of digestive enzymes that break down various kinds of food. The pancreas, which is the central organ that we have discussed produces three kinds of main digestive enzymes. These include:

  • Amylase is a enzyme that helps break down complex carbohydrates. Amylase is a enzyme that breaks down complex. Also , it is produced in the mouth.
  • Lipase, which breaks down fats.
  • Protease helps break down proteins.

The small intestine is also the source of some major enzymes which include:

  • Lactase is a enzyme that breaks down lactose.
  • Sucrase which breaks down sucrose.

When the body lacks certain enzymes, or if the body does not have the ability to release the required enzymes, they could be being affected by a disease known as digestive enzyme insufficiency.

When someone suffers from digestive enzyme insufficiency is unable to break down certain foods and absorb specific nutrients. Lactose intolerance is one such case wherein the body cannot produce enough lactase to digest sugars found in dairy and milk products.

Digestive Enzyme Insufficiency (DEI) isn’t an illness to be taken lightly. It can cause malnutrition and gastrointestinal irritation. Signs of it include:

  • Cramps or pain in the belly
  • Bloating
  • Diarrhea
  • Gas
  • Stomach oily
  • Weight loss that is not explained.

Protein Enzymes

Protein enzymes are among the active enzymes in the body as they serve multiple roles in the body. Among these functions is breaking down proteins that the body consumes and converting them to amino acids.

The protein enzymes within VitaPost Digestive Enzymes include Protease 1 and 2. Bromelain, Papain, Aspergillopepsin and Peptidase

  • Proteases 1 and 2 These enzymes are among the most essential in the process of proteolysis which is the process of breaking down the protein into amino acids. Furthermore, these two can be utilized to develop new protein products.
  • Bromelain – This is a type of enzyme that is be found in the juice of a pineapple, and specifically at the stem of the pineapple. For a long time, it’s been used in Asia as a treatment for soreness, burns, and pain of the muscle along with numerous other ailments.
  • Papain – A different enzyme that assists in the breakdown of protein into amino acids as well as Peptides. Papain is found only and extracted from raw papatay fruit. In addition to breaking down protein, papain could assist in neutralizing toxic chemicals found in meats, cheeses, and even nuts.
  • Aspergillopepsin – Another enzyme which breaks down gluten. Unlike mammalian pepsin, aspergillopepsin is able to extensively hydrolyze gluten from food into peptides that are short.
  • Peptidase – They are enzymes which are able to break down gluten. Peptidase can be used to cleave and often inactivating small peptides. Not only do they break proteins, but they are also important for modifying many proteins.

  • Lactase – This enzyme mostly process lactose, a chemical present in milk. An imbalance in lactase could cause a person to be lactose intolerant. Lactase breaks down the sugars that is present in milk into two simple sugars: galactose as well as glucose.
  • Beta-glucanase is an enzyme that results in the hydrolysis of beta-glucans. In general, it breaks down the sugars found in oats and barley, where beta-glucans are the present in the microorganism cell walls.
  • Invertase invertase Invertase is named after an inverted sugar syrup. The process that creates this substance originates from breaking down sucrose into fructose and glucose which were sugar syrup that was previously referred to as an inverted syrup.
